Bain-backed autocomp player RSB Transmissions initiates talks for Rs.3,000-Cr IPO
Global private equity firm Bain Capital has initiated talks with bankers to take its portfolio company, Pune-based RSB Transmissions , public. The automotive component manufacturer is planning to raise about INR 3,000 crore through an initial public offering.Founded in 1973 by R.K. Behera and S.K. Behera, RSB Transmissions designs and manufactures components such as propeller shafts, axles, and gearboxes for commercial vehicles, passenger cars, and construction equipment. The company operates manufacturing facilities across India and has an international site in Mexico, serving original equipment manufacturers including Tata Motors, Ashok Leyland, and John Deere.In September 2024, Bain Capital invested in the company to support organic growth and strategic acquisitions. This June, the firm also funded RSB’s acquisition of Setco Auto Systems through an equity infusion of INR 525 crore from Bain Capital and INR 115 crore from the company’s promoters. Currently, Bain Capital holds a 64.3% stake in the firm.
Between Jul 2006 and Jan 2026, RSB Group had attracted about $188-M from Bain Capital, Evolvence, IIML, Others.For FY25, RSB Group had reported about INR 2,680 Cr in Operating Income and about INR 72 Cr in PAT.
